CNC machining requires careful attention to components, technology, setup, planning, and maintenance to boost precision and efficiency, leading to time and cost savings, increased productivity, consistent quality, sustainability, and a competitive edge. Key factors influencing machining efficiency include machine setup, cutting tools, production materials, and optimized programming. To improve precision, operators should ensure proper machine setup, fine-tune cutting parameters, and select high-quality components and tools tailored to specific tasks. Efficient CAD/CAM programming and simulation software can help identify inefficiencies before production begins. Operational elements like quality control, organized floor management, effective production planning, and enhanced inventory management are crucial for maintaining high standards and minimizing downtime. In the competitive landscape of manufacturing, CNC machine shops continually seek ways to enhance productivity and efficiency. Implementing computer-aided manufacturing (CAM) automation significantly reduces programming time, minimizes errors, and optimizes machining processes. Leveraging CNC programming automation through macro programming and integrating third-party automation hardware can further streamline operations, allowing for unattended production and quicker adaptations to new products. Additionally, optimizing the CAM workflow by integrating CAD and CAM systems, utilizing cloud collaboration, and automating routine tasks accelerates the transition from design to production. Adopting smart machining strategies, such as using high-quality cutting tools, implementing in-process inspection, and optimizing cutting parameters, contributes to improved productivity. Overall, enhancing CNC machine shop productivity involves a combination of smart strategies, automation, and continuous refinement of machining processes. In production manufacturing, efficiency is paramount, and CNC machines are essential tools that enhance throughput while ensuring consistent quality. CNC machine centers offer five significant advantages: First, they excel in speed, capable of exceeding 2,300 inches per minute while achieving high precision and repeatability in machining tasks. Second, flexibility is a hallmark of CNC machining, allowing easy programming and adaptation for various parts through interchangeable tools and fixtures. Third, automation features, such as automatic tool changers and pallet systems, improve operational efficiency by minimizing manual intervention. Fourth, adaptability is evident with tool capacity, pallet automation, and the integration of advanced sensors and robotics, enhancing production capabilities. Finally, the supply base of CNC machines benefits from legacy reliability, competitive market dynamics, and strong manufacturing partnerships that drive innovation and customization.
